Explanation:
Unit Rate means the number of times Jake cleans his house PER WEEK.
Since he clean his house only 3 times per 7 weeks, we will have a number less than 1 (per week). To get unit rate, we divide the number of times (3) with the number of weeks (7). Thus:
Unit Rate =
times in 1 week
Now, we can set up a ratio (2 fractions), equate them and solve for the unknown [let times he clean his house in 52 weeks be x]. Shown below:

To solve this, we cross multiply and use basic algebra and solve for x:

That's 22.29 times in 52 weeks (let's round and say 22 times).
